Municipal Pump Market Forecast 2025-2035: Growth, Innovation, and Opportunities for Global Manufacturers

Municipal pump market set to grow steadily, driven by urbanization, sustainable solutions, and smart technologies, offering new revenue opportunities.
Published 23 September 2025

The municipal pump market is on a trajectory of sustained expansion, estimated at USD 4.4 billion in 2025 and projected to reach USD 6.8 billion by 2035, reflecting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.5%. This growth represents an absolute dollar opportunity of USD 2.4 billion over the forecast period, highlighting the tangible revenue potential for both established industry leaders and new market entrants.

Urbanization and rising demand for efficient water and wastewater management systems are key drivers of this growth. Municipalities across North America, Europe, and Asia-Pacific are investing heavily in modern water supply, wastewater treatment, and flood control infrastructure. These investments provide manufacturers with opportunities to expand production, optimize distribution networks, and introduce innovative pumping solutions to meet increasing demand.

Segment Insights: Dominance of Centrifugal and Electric Pumps

Centrifugal pumps are projected to capture nearly half of the market revenue in 2025, driven by their simple design, reliability, and suitability for both water distribution and sewage handling. Electric and solar pumps are expected to account for 69.2% of revenue, highlighting the ongoing shift toward energy-efficient and environmentally friendly technologies. These pumps offer scalable solutions for urban and semi-urban municipalities, combining operational efficiency with sustainability.

Pumps with flow rates of 100 to 500 cubic meters per hour are the most widely adopted, representing 52.7% of the market revenue. These units balance energy consumption and performance, making them ideal for medium-scale municipal applications. This flow rate category allows municipal planners to implement reliable water transfer and wastewater management systems while maintaining cost efficiency.

Regional Trends and Country-Level Insights

North America and Europe emphasize high-capacity, energy-efficient pumps equipped with automation and smart monitoring to comply with environmental standards and reduce operational costs. In contrast, Asia-Pacific countries, particularly China and India, focus on medium-capacity, cost-effective solutions that support rapid urbanization and municipal infrastructure development. China leads with a 6.1% CAGR, driven by smart city projects, large-scale urban water networks, and adoption of IoT-enabled pumping systems. India follows at 5.6% CAGR, supported by initiatives for clean water supply, wastewater infrastructure expansion, and rising industrial water demand.

Germany, at 5.2% CAGR, focuses on durable, energy-efficient pumps integrated with predictive maintenance systems, while the United Kingdom maintains moderate growth at 4.3% CAGR. The United States, a mature market expanding at 3.8% CAGR, prioritizes reliability, energy efficiency, and automation in municipal water applications. These regional patterns underscore the diverse approaches to municipal water management, influenced by infrastructure, budgets, and regulatory frameworks.

Competitive Landscape and Key Players

The municipal pump market features a mix of established leaders and innovative newcomers. Key players include Xylem Inc, Grundfos Pumps Corporation, Sulzer Ltd, Pentair plc, EBARA Pumps Americas Corporation, Liberty Pumps, Crane Pumps & Systems, Blackmer, CORNELL PUMP COMPANY, EXAIR LLC, MDM Incorporated, NETZSCH Pumps & Systems, SEEPEX, Inc., Smith & Loveless Inc., and Wanner Engineering, Inc.

Competition is shaped by hydraulic efficiency, energy consumption, durability, and ease of maintenance. Companies are increasingly offering modular designs, automation-ready units, and environmentally compliant components. Suppliers differentiate through smart, application-specific solutions, aftermarket support, and system integration, while regional manufacturers focus on cost-effective options. Product features such as corrosion- and abrasion-resistant coatings, variable-speed drives, and IoT-enabled monitoring enhance operational performance and longevity, providing municipal operators with reliable, energy-optimized solutions.
